Unforced errors Maria Sharapova – Kommersant

Russian sport has been the victim of another doping scandal loud. On meldonium use the drug, also known as mildronat, which entered the list of prohibited only from 1 January of this year, got perhaps its brightest star – Maria Sharapova. Ms. Sharapova admitted that she suffered through his own fault, ignoring the warning of the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A). The richest athlete of the world is now facing disqualification, as well as financial losses amount to tens of millions of dollars: Maria Sharapova sponsors already claim the severance of relations with it. A Russian sport because meldonium faces new doping crisis, no less ambitious than the one victim who last year became the domestic athletics. The victim of this drug became or will become in the near future a few more athletes, including the hero of the winter season skater Paul Kulizhnikova.

About what happened to her, Maria Sharapova said at a special press conference held in Los Angeles on the night of Monday to Tuesday Moscow time. “I failed a doping test, and fully accept the responsibility for it,” – announced the tennis player. It turned out that this is a sample, which she took on January 26 of this year. On this day, Maria Sharapova lost in the Australian Open quarter-finals, the first of the season Grand Slam tournament, American Serena Williams. The sample revealed the presence of traces in the body athletes meldonium.

Almost all previously convicted of application meldonium athletes explained their problems mistake made out of ignorance. After all, until recently it was considered a harmless drug, most prophylactic. At higher loads meldonium restores the balance between delivery and cellular oxygen demand, eliminating the accumulation of toxic products of metabolism in the cells, protecting them from damage, plus has a tonic effect. As a result of its use of the body acquires the ability to quickly restore energy reserves. Meldonium used to treat a variety of disorders of the cardiovascular system, the blood supply to the brain, as well as to improve physical and mental performance.

In many countries, including in Russia, it is sold without a prescription. Its founder Ivar Kalvins in an interview with radio station Baltkom said that the drug “is intended to protect the heart and brain in the case of oxygen deficiency,” from which “you can die,” and “apply and heart disease.” Mr. Kalvins flatly refuses to call it a “stimulant”. “I think this is the lobby of manufacturers of carnitine. This drug is the most common nutritional supplement used by athletes, bodybuilders. Our group, which once developed meldonium unfortunately ascertained that carnitine – not a harmless tool, it can affect the development of Since atherosclerosis that its producers thus want to affect the competition, “-. said Mr. Kalvins.

Meanwhile, on January 1 this year, the World Anti-Doping Agency meldonium included in the prohibited list.

Explanation of Maria Sharapova, in essence, no different from those given earlier meldonium victim. According tennis player, she regularly took the drug for a decade. Lawyer John Haggerty Ms. Sharapova said that she used it to “improve”, “in accordance with the doctor’s recommendations” based on “a series of surveys.” The “abnormal electrocardiogram indicators” and “signs of diabetes” were recorded during these surveys.

Maria Sharapova confessed that on 22 December WADA sent her mail email informing about the changes made to the list of banned drugs, but the athlete “not clicked” on it. “I let down my fans and their sport, which I do with four years and which I truly love” – ​​Ms. Sharapova repented.

The International Tennis Federation (ITF) has reported that since March 12, Maria Sharapova, currently ranked seventh in the world ranking, will be temporarily suspended from the competition. Now ITF to take a decision on the basic sanctions for athletes. The range is quite wide.

John Haggerty, referring to the anti-doping regulations, recalled that an athlete who has been banned substance intentionally supposed four-year disqualification. If the offense committed out of ignorance, it is half term. But the presence of extenuating circumstances the punishment may be much less severe.

Mr. Haggerty sure that in the case of his client of such circumstances are obvious. In particular, he pointed out that “Mary made use of the drug in much smaller doses” than those athletes who hoped to “make money thanks to him an advantage over others.” In addition, for the benefit of Mrs. Sharapova could play a confession of guilt, as well as the position of the tennis public.

Even more weighty look of its financial losses. Since the middle of the last decade, Maria Sharapova has consistently ranked first in the ranking of the highest paid athletes according to Forbes the world. Last year, its revenues amounted to $ 29.5 million, and three-quarters of them – $ 23 million – has been earned not on the court, and advertising contracts. Their Ms. Sharapova was really much more than any other athlete in the world.

The situation changed immediately after the press conference. First, the severance of relations with Maria Sharapova “pending investigation,” the company said Nike. After her refusal to renew the contract with tennis player informed the Swiss watch brand TAG Heuer. Then he informed that “postpones the planned activities” with the star, Porsche. Because of this, Maria Sharapova will lose in the long run a few tens of millions of dollars. Especially troublesome seems possible loss of Nike. According to US sources, the amount of signed tennis with sportswear manufacturer in 2010, eight-year contract is $ 70 million.
